Pretrial hearing set as Matthew Farwell trial on Sandra Birchmore murder approaches

Stoughton residents will hear the last pre‑trial hearing on Thursday afternoon, less than two weeks before the murder trial of former police detective Matthew Farwell is slated to begin on Oct. 5. The hearing follows a recent federal ruling that allows Farwell’s defense to present evidence about the victim’s mental‑health struggles, while the prosecution may refer to Sandra Birchmore as a victim.

Background of the case

Birchmore, a 23‑year‑old woman who was pregnant with an unborn child at the time of her death, was found dead in 2024. Investigators say Farwell staged the scene to appear as a suicide. Earlier this year, a federal judge denied Farwell bail, describing the evidence against him as “very strong, if not overwhelming.”

Police misconduct allegations

The case has drawn additional community attention because Birchmore had previously been involved with the Stoughton Police Department’s youth explorers program. The department’s chief disclosed that three officers had inappropriate relationships with her, including one sexual relationship that began when she was 15. All three officers resigned after an internal investigation.

Trial logistics

Prosecutors estimate the trial will run about 20 days and have asked the judge to schedule two half‑day sessions each week, citing the “intensity of the trial.” They anticipate calling roughly 50 witnesses, ranging from law‑enforcement personnel and civilians to 12 expert witnesses.

What’s next

The upcoming hearing will address remaining pre‑trial matters, including any final motions from the defense and prosecution. As the community awaits the trial, many residents hope the proceedings will bring clarity and justice for Birchmore, her family, and her unborn child.
